Career path

Career Role Description
Energy Hedging Analyst Analyze energy markets, develop and implement hedging strategies to mitigate price risk for energy companies. High demand for analytical and risk management skills.
Energy Risk Manager Identify, assess, and manage financial and operational risks associated with energy trading and production. Requires expertise in energy hedging and derivatives.
Commodity Trader (Energy Focus) Buy and sell energy commodities (oil, gas, electricity) to maximize profits. Requires deep understanding of energy markets and hedging techniques.
Financial Analyst (Energy Sector) Analyze financial data for energy companies, providing insights for investment decisions. Incorporates energy pricing forecasts and hedging strategies into analysis.

A Professional Certificate in Energy Hedging is increasingly significant in today's volatile UK energy market. The UK's reliance on energy imports, coupled with geopolitical instability and fluctuating demand, creates substantial price risks for businesses. According to Ofgem, UK household energy bills increased by 54% in 2022. This highlights the crucial need for effective energy risk management strategies, making expertise in energy hedging highly sought after.

The ability to predict and mitigate price volatility through various hedging techniques—such as futures contracts, options, and swaps—is paramount for energy producers, consumers, and traders alike.
